The Mediterranean diet has long been applauded for its health benefits, including positive impacts on heart health, 

bone strength and diabetes management – and it’s earned the title of “No. 1 Best Diet Overall” for a reason. But how does the diet fare for losing weight?

When used with intention, experts say that the Mediterranean diet can support healthy weight loss. 

However, because weight loss is dependent on expending more energy than you are taking in – or, burning more calories than you consume – this eating style alone does not guarantee a new number on the scale.

Rather than dedicating one hour to a HIIT training and calling it a day, the Mediterranean diet encourages regular, more consistent movement throughout the day.

The more movement we incorporate on a day-to-day basis, the more likely we burn calories and slim down.

Further, nourishing your body with lean proteins and whole grains – hallmarks of the Mediterranean diet – can increase your energy levels and help ward off cravings for a less nutritious snack.

Diets that are very low in carbohydrates or very low in fats can be effective in promoting weight loss, but, in my experience, people get tired of the restrictions.

I've found that a Mediterranean diet pattern is one that people find easier to adopt as a long-term behavior change.
